Why is Furnace Duct Cleaning Important?

Furnace ducts are integral components of HVAC systems, channeling warm air throughout buildings. Over time, these ducts can accumulate dust, dirt, and other debris, which can obstruct airflow and reduce efficiency. A clean duct system ensures optimal airflow, which is crucial for maintaining the performance of your furnace.

The Impact of Dirty Ducts on Energy Consumption

When furnace ducts are clogged with debris, your heating system has to work harder to push air through the vents. This increased effort translates into higher energy consumption and, consequently, elevated energy bills. By investing in regular duct cleaning, you can enhance the efficiency of your furnace, leading to significant energy savings.

How Does Furnace Duct Cleaning Lead to Energy Savings?

Cleaning your ducts can significantly reduce the amount of work your furnace needs to perform. When airflow is unimpeded, the furnace uses less energy to maintain the desired temperature, which in turn reduces the overall energy consumption. Moreover, clean ducts help in maintaining consistent indoor temperatures, further contributing to energy efficiency.

Long-Term Benefits of Clean Ducts

Besides immediate energy savings, regular cleaning of furnace ducts can extend the lifespan of your HVAC system. By reducing wear and tear on the system, you minimize the risk of costly repairs or replacements in the future. This proactive maintenance approach not only saves money but also enhances the reliability of your heating systems.

Steps to Ensure Effective Furnace Duct Cleaning

To achieve the best results from duct cleaning, it is essential to follow a systematic approach. Here are the steps you should consider:

1. Conduct a Thorough Inspection

Before beginning the cleaning process, inspect the ductwork for visible signs of dirt and damage. This inspection will help you identify areas that need special attention, ensuring a comprehensive cleaning process.

2. Use the Right Equipment

Proper equipment is crucial for effective duct cleaning. High-powered vacuums and specialized brushes are typically used to remove debris and contaminants from the ductwork.

3. Hire Professional Services

While DIY duct cleaning can be effective for minor maintenance, hiring professional services ensures a thorough and efficient cleaning process. Professionals have the expertise and tools necessary to clean your ducts effectively, leading to better energy savings.

When Should You Clean Your Furnace Ducts?

The frequency of duct cleaning depends on several factors, including the age of your HVAC system, the presence of pets, and the level of indoor air pollution. As a general rule, it is recommended to clean your ducts every 3 to 5 years. However, if you notice an increase in dust accumulation or a decline in air quality, you may need to clean them more frequently.

Indicators That Your Ducts Need Cleaning

Signs that indicate your ducts need cleaning include visible dust around vents, an increase in allergy symptoms among building occupants, and unusual odors coming from the HVAC system.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further complications and enhance energy savings.

Enhancing Energy Savings Through Additional Measures

In addition to duct cleaning, there are other strategies you can implement to maximize energy savings:

1. Regular Maintenance of HVAC Systems

Routine maintenance of your heating and cooling systems can prevent inefficiencies and ensure optimal performance. This includes changing air filters regularly and checking for leaks or blockages in the ductwork.

2. Upgrade to Energy-Efficient Equipment

Consider upgrading to energy-efficient HVAC systems that consume less power and provide better heating performance. Modern systems are designed to be more efficient, reducing energy consumption and lowering utility bills.

3. Insulate Your Home

Proper insulation helps maintain indoor temperatures, reducing the workload on your heating systems. By minimizing heat loss, you can achieve substantial energy savings throughout the year.
